package net.rubyeye.xmemcached.command.text;
import java.nio.ByteBuffer;
import java.util.concurrent.CountDownLatch;
import net.rubyeye.xmemcached.command.VerbosityCommand;
import net.rubyeye.xmemcached.impl.MemcachedTCPSession;
import net.rubyeye.xmemcached.monitor.Constants;
import net.rubyeye.xmemcached.utils.ByteUtils;
import com.google.code.yanf4j.buffer.IoBuffer;
/**
* Verbosity command for text protocol
*
* @author dennis
*
*/
public class TextVerbosityCommand extends VerbosityCommand {
public static final String VERBOSITY = "verbosity";
public TextVerbosityCommand(CountDownLatch latch, int level, boolean noreply) {
super(latch, level, noreply);
}
@Override
public boolean decode(MemcachedTCPSession session, ByteBuffer buffer) {
if (buffer == null || !buffer.hasRemaining()) {
return false;
}
if (this.result == null) {
byte first = buffer.get(buffer.position());
if (first == 'O') {
setResult(Boolean.TRUE);
countDownLatch();
// OK\r\n
return ByteUtils.stepBuffer(buffer, 4);
} else {
return decodeError(session, buffer);
}
} else {
return ByteUtils.stepBuffer(buffer, 4);
}
}
@Override
public void encode() {
final byte[] levelBytes = ByteUtils
.getBytes(String.valueOf(this.level));
if (isNoreply()) {
this.ioBuffer = IoBuffer.allocate(4 + VERBOSITY.length()
+ levelBytes.length + Constants.NO_REPLY.length);
ByteUtils.setArguments(this.ioBuffer, VERBOSITY, levelBytes,
Constants.NO_REPLY);
} else {
this.ioBuffer = IoBuffer.allocate(2 + 1 + VERBOSITY.length()
+ levelBytes.length);
ByteUtils.setArguments(this.ioBuffer, VERBOSITY, levelBytes);
}
this.ioBuffer.flip();
}
}
